Subject: Re: [PATCH v11 1/8] mm: rust: add abstraction for struct mm_struct
Date: Wed, 15 Jan 2025 11:36:56 +0100	[thread overview]
Message-ID: <87a5bse52v.fsf@kernel.org> (raw)
In-Reply-To: <CAH5fLginc=uNPVp1-T-oBrgtE1oi_cBMd65sPkDgqSDjH_CNfA@mail.gmail.com> (Alice Ryhl's message of "Mon, 13 Jan 2025 10:53:33 +0100")

"Alice Ryhl" <aliceryhl@google.com> writes:

> On Mon, Dec 16, 2024 at 3:50 PM Andreas Hindborg <a.hindborg@kernel.org> wrote:
>>
>> "Alice Ryhl" <aliceryhl@google.com> writes:
>>
>> > These abstractions allow you to reference a `struct mm_struct` using
>> > both mmgrab and mmget refcounts. This is done using two Rust types:
>> >
>> > * Mm - represents an mm_struct where you don't know anything about the
>> >   value of mm_users.
>> > * MmWithUser - represents an mm_struct where you know at compile time
>> >   that mm_users is non-zero.
>> >
>> > This allows us to encode in the type system whether a method requires
>> > that mm_users is non-zero or not. For instance, you can always call
>> > `mmget_not_zero` but you can only call `mmap_read_lock` when mm_users is
>> > non-zero.
>> >
>> > It's possible to access current->mm without a refcount increment, but
>> > that is added in a later patch of this series.
>> >

>> Could you add a little more context here?
>
> How about this?
>
> //! Memory management.
> //!
> //! This module deals with managing the address space of userspace
> processes. Each process has an
> //! instance of [`Mm`], which keeps track of multiple VMAs (virtual
> memory areas). Each VMA
> //! corresponds to a region of memory that the userspace process can
> access, and the VMA lets you
> //! control what happens when userspace reads or writes to that region
> of memory.
> //!
> //! C header: [`include/linux/mm.h`](srctree/include/linux/mm.h)

Nice 👍

>
>> > +//!
>> > +//! C header: [`include/linux/mm.h`](srctree/include/linux/mm.h)
>> > +
>> > +use crate::{
>> > +    bindings,
>> > +    types::{ARef, AlwaysRefCounted, NotThreadSafe, Opaque},
>> > +};
>> > +use core::{ops::Deref, ptr::NonNull};
>> > +
>> > +/// A wrapper for the kernel's `struct mm_struct`.
>>
>> Could you elaborate the data structure use case? When do I need it, what
>> does it do?
>
> How about this?
>
> /// A wrapper for the kernel's `struct mm_struct`.
> ///
> /// This represents the address space of a userspace process, so each
> process has one `Mm`
> /// instance. It may hold many VMAs internally.
> ///
> /// There is a counter called `mm_users` that counts the users of the
> address space; this includes
> /// the userspace process itself, but can also include kernel threads
> accessing the address space.
> /// Once `mm_users` reaches zero, this indicates that the address
> space can be destroyed. To access
> /// the address space, you must prevent `mm_users` from reaching zero
> while you are accessing it.
> /// The [`MmWithUser`] type represents an address space where this is
> guaranteed, and you can
> /// create one using [`mmget_not_zero`].
> ///
> /// The `ARef<Mm>` smart pointer holds an `mmgrab` refcount. Its
> destructor may sleep.

Cool 👍

>> Could we come up with a better name? `MemoryMap` or `MemoryMapping`?. You
>> use `MMapReadGuard` later.
>
> Those names seem really confusing to me. The mmap syscall creates a
> new VMA, but MemoryMap sounds like it's the thing that mmap creates.
>
> Lorenzo, what do you think? I'm inclined to just call it Mm since
> that's what C calls it.

Well I guess there is value in using same names as C. The additional
docs you sent help a lot so I guess it is fine.

If we were writing from scratch I would have held hard on `AddressSpace`
or `MemoryMap` over `Mm`. `Mm` has got to be one of the least
descriptive names we can come up with.
